BEATTIE v. BEATTIE

No. 88-1212.

536 So.2d 1078 (1988)

James Sweetman BEATTIE, Appellant, v. Juno Marie BEATTIE, and Celebrities, Inc., D/B/a Wexy, Appellees.

District Court of Appeal of Florida, Fourth District.

November 9, 1988.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

M. Ross Shulmister of Law Offices of M. Ross Shulmister, Fort Lauderdale, for appellant.

Randolph W. Adams, Fort Lauderdale, for appellee Juno Marie Beattie.


DOWNEY, Judge.

The marriage of James and Juno Beattie was dissolved in November, 1983. The judgment contained a property settlement agreement in which James agreed to maintain a life insurance policy on his life for $100,000 naming Juno as irrevocable beneficiary.
